Definition
Country of origin; the original place of production of a product.
neutralshoppingwork
How it's used
Focuses specifically on the geographical location where a product is manufactured or grown. It is frequently used in formal or commercial contexts, such as on product labels or in customs declarations, rather than in casual daily conversation.

Common mistake
Avoid using this to refer to the origin of a person or a concept, as it is strictly reserved for physical products or goods. For a person's place of birth or origin, use 出生地 or 鄉下 instead.
